- IITs (Indian Institutes of Technology): Some IITs offer online degree programs and certificate courses that may be relevant. Keep an eye on their websites for specific M.Sc. Mathematics programs.
- NITs (National Institutes of Technology): Similar to IITs, NITs are premier engineering and technology institutes that might offer online options.
- IGNOU (Indira Gandhi National Open University): IGNOU is a well-known open university that provides distance education programs, including mathematics.
- Manipal University Jaipur: Offers a fully online M.Sc. in Mathematics program designed for comprehensive learning.
- Amity University Online: Another popular choice, offering a flexible online M.Sc. in Mathematics program.
- Accreditation: Ensure that the university and the program are accredited by relevant bodies like UGC (University Grants Commission) or NAAC (National Assessment and Accreditation Council). Accreditation ensures that the program meets quality standards and is recognized by employers.
- Curriculum: Review the curriculum carefully to see if it covers the topics and specializations that interest you. A good program should offer a balance of core mathematical concepts and advanced topics, such as analysis, algebra, topology, and numerical methods.
- Faculty: Look into the faculty members teaching the courses. Experienced and knowledgeable faculty can significantly enhance your learning experience. Check their qualifications, research interests, and teaching experience.
- Technology and Platform: Make sure the online learning platform is user-friendly and reliable. The platform should provide access to course materials, video lectures, discussion forums, and other resources. It should also be compatible with your devices and internet connection.
- Support Services: Check what kind of support services the university offers to online students. These may include academic advising, tutoring, technical support, career counseling, and library access. A strong support system can help you overcome challenges and succeed in your studies.
- Flexibility: Evaluate how the program fits into your lifestyle. Does it offer asynchronous learning options, allowing you to study at your own pace? Are there flexible assignment deadlines and exam schedules? Choose a program that allows you to balance your studies with your other commitments.

- Data Scientist: Analyze large datasets to identify trends, patterns, and insights. Develop machine learning models to solve business problems.
- Financial Analyst: Use mathematical models to analyze financial data, assess investment risks, and make recommendations to clients.
- Research Scientist: Conduct research in mathematics or related fields. Develop new theories, models, and algorithms.
- Statistician: Collect, analyze, and interpret data to support decision-making in various fields, such as healthcare, marketing, and government.
- Actuary: Assess and manage financial risks for insurance companies and other organizations.
- Mathematics Teacher/Professor: Teach mathematics at the school or university level. Inspire the next generation of mathematicians.
- Software Developer: Use mathematical concepts and algorithms to develop software applications and solve computational problems.
- Operations Research Analyst: Use mathematical techniques to optimize business operations and improve efficiency.
- Create a study schedule: Set aside specific times for studying and stick to your schedule as much as possible. Consistency is key to success in online learning.
- Find a quiet study space: Choose a location where you can focus without distractions. This could be a home office, a library, or a coffee shop.
- Participate actively: Engage in online discussions, ask questions, and collaborate with your classmates. Active participation enhances your learning and helps you build a strong network.
- Manage your time wisely: Break down large tasks into smaller, more manageable chunks. Prioritize your assignments and avoid procrastination.
- Seek help when needed: Don't hesitate to reach out to your professors, teaching assistants, or classmates if you're struggling with the material. There are many resources available to support your learning.
- Stay motivated: Set goals, reward yourself for achieving milestones, and remember why you're pursuing this degree. Staying motivated will help you overcome challenges and stay on track.
- Take breaks: Regular breaks are essential for maintaining focus and preventing burnout. Get up and move around, do something you enjoy, and give your brain a rest.

Admission Requirements and Eligibility
So, what does it take to get into an online M.Sc. Mathematics program? Generally, you'll need a Bachelor's degree in Mathematics or a related field from a recognized university. Some universities may also require a minimum percentage or CGPA in your undergraduate studies. Make sure to check the specific admission requirements of the university you're interested in.
Typical documents required for admission include:
Some universities may conduct an entrance exam or interview as part of the admission process. This helps them assess your mathematical aptitude and readiness for the program. Prepare well for the entrance exam by reviewing your undergraduate mathematics concepts and practicing problem-solving.
